Aquatic combat has been removed from PvP with the removal of Raid on the Capricorn.

It still crops up very rarely in WvW, namely around BL Bay keep, and sometimes around EB Lowlands Keep.

Aquatic Combat is a pretty fun and highly underrated aspect of the game in my opinion. A lot of people dislike it because they never take the time to analyze what works and what doesn’t underwater – as well as the fact that there are usually entire skill types that are simply not usable underwater, which may wreck some builds.

It’s hardly mandatory – it’s presence in dungeons for example is pretty rare with a few exceptions. There are tasks that take place wholly underwater, as well as points of interests, skill points and vistas.

But you probably will spend a vast majority of the game out of water, outside of exploring.

I’ve personally not played any other MMOs or many other RPG’s for that matter with underwater combat, but most seem to think GW2 has done it in a good, fairly enjoyable way by comparison. Still, it seems like underwater combat itself is fairly unpopular.

Edit: There also has been basically no new content in the form of Living Story that even has any underwater combat, aside from a Fractal and Southsun having underwater elements on the map. None of Living World events at Southsun ever even brought you underwater.

You’d honestly be fine with a masterwork aquatic weapon from general loot. Consider a cheap karma bought aquabreather too.

That’s honestly true for all aspects of GW2: Knowing the fights and how to play your class is waaaay more important than gear or equipment rarity.
